Hello,
I have recently bought a Toshiba Sattelite C650D laptop, and tried to put my old laptop's (ACER Aspire 5315) hard drive in. Both are SATA. When I start the Toshiba, it boots, goes to the windows logo, and restarts immediately. I did a command prompt test, and it gave me Windows Error 1312. Note: Both drives contain windows 7, and the toshiba hd is bigger (120GB - acer, 320GB - Toshiba) What do?

A Windows instillation on a hard disk is customized to the motherboard hardware. Often it will not boot when transferred to a different model PC. You can use imaging software to copy the Toshiba hard drive to the ACER drive. That will erase the contents of the ACER drive.
